Most widely affecting species include Culex quinquefasciatus, A. albopictus and A. aegypti which serve as vectors for many hematophagous diseases. Various control measures have been used to control the mosquitoes but most important is the use of synthetic insecticides. This research focused on the use of botanical extracts and green synthesized silver nanoparticles of four different plants i.e. Moringa Olifera, Zingiber officinale, Syzygium aromaticum and Datura stramonium. Percent mean mortality was calculated. The results of the study indicated that on maximum concentration and all-out exposure time (96 hours) of application of plant extracts and green synthesized silver nanoparticles on mosquitoes Moringa Olifera based plant extract give highest percent mortality that was 79% and Silver nanoparticles of that plant also give highest percent mortality that was 92%.
